A large photographic print is displayed on a metal easel outdoors at night in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am. The print depicts an indoor packing area where three individuals—two males and one female—are sorting numerous round, green-to-orange fruits, identified as Tân Uyên Northern Oranges. One male wears a blue cap and grey shirt; another male wears a beige cap and light collared shirt; the female wears a red shirt. They are positioned amidst an array of plastic crates (red, blue, green) filled with the fruit. Numerous black plastic crates are stacked in the background. The print is labeled at the bottom with "Tác phẩm: CAM BẮC TÂN UYÊN" (Title: Tân Uyên Northern Oranges) and "Tác giả: Đặng Đề" (Author: Đặng Đề). The easel rests on cracked concrete pavement. In the background beyond the print, blurred yellow string lights, red lanterns, and illuminated trees indicate a festive or commercially lit urban outdoor environment in Ho Chi Minh City.
